Popular spot with a 1.5-mi. hiking trail through a longleaf pine forest featuring scenic overlooks.

Great 1.5 mile hike in some beautiful longleaf pine and sweetgum bottoms. With benches along the way and a couple of look offs on the trail. Picking area and bathroom are available here also!
